Postnatal vitamin D supplementation is standard of care in neonates and preterm infants. Despite routine supplementation of vitamin D, a wide range of complications related to vitamin D deficiency ...has been described in the literature. Since standard vitamin D supplementation might be not sufficient in preterm infants with a genetic predisposition for vitamin D deficiency, we investigated the outcome of preterm infants with regard to their genetic estimated vitamin D levels.
Preterm infants with a birth weight below 1500 grams were included in the German Neonatal Network at the time of their birth and tested at the age of five. The vitamin D level was genetically calculated based on three single nucleotide polymorphisms (SNPs: rs12794714, rs7944926 and rs2282679) which alter vitamin D synthesis pathways. Specific alleles of these polymorphisms are validated markers for low plasma vitamin D levels. Outcome data were based on baseline data at the time of birth, typical complications of prematurity, body measurements at the age of five and occurrence of bone fractures. T-test and Fisher's exact test were used for statistical comparison.
According to their genetic predisposition, 1,924 preterm infants were divided into groups of low (gsVitD < 20. Percentile), intermediate and high vitamin D level estimates. Low genetic vitamin D level estimates could not be shown to be associated with any adverse outcome measures examined. The analyses covered data on aforementioned determinants.
Low genetic vitamin D level estimates could not be shown to be associated with previously described adverse outcome in preterm infants.

Regulatory T cells (Tregs) are important for the ontogenetic control of immune activation and tissue damage in preterm infants. However, the role of Tregs for the development of bronchopulmonary ...dysplasia (BPD) is yet unclear. The aim of our study was to characterize CD4+ CD25+ forkhead box protein 3 (FoxP3)+ Tregs in peripheral blood of well-phenotyped preterm infants (
= 382; 23 + 0 - 36 + 6 weeks of gestational age) with a focus on the first 28 days of life and the clinical endpoint BPD (supplemental oxygen for longer than 28 days of age). In a subgroup of preterm infants, we characterized the immunological phenotype of Tregs (
= 23). The suppressive function of Tregs on CD4+CD25- T cells was compared in preterm, term and adult blood. We observed that extreme prematurity was associated with increased Treg frequencies which peaked in the second week of life. Independent of gestational age, increased Treg frequencies were noted to precede the development of BPD. The phenotype of preterm infant Tregs largely differed from adult Tregs and displayed an overall naïve Treg population (CD45RA+/HLA-DR-/Helios+), especially in the first days of life. On day 7 of life, a more activated Treg phenotype pattern (CCR6+, HLA-DR+, and Ki-67+) was observed. Tregs of preterm neonates had a higher immunosuppressive capacity against CD4+CD25- T cells compared to the Treg compartment of term neonates and adults. In conclusion, our data suggest increased frequencies and functions of Tregs in preterm neonates which display a distinct phenotype with dynamic changes in the first weeks of life. Hence, the continued abundance of Tregs may contribute to sustained inflammation preceding the development of BPD. Functional analyses are needed in order to elucidate whether Tregs have potential as future target for diagnostics and therapeutics.
Abstract Background Very-low-birth-weight infants (VLBWI) are frequently delivered by cesarean section (CS). However, it is unclear at what gestational age the benefits of spontaneous delivery ...outweigh the perinatal risks, i.e. intraventricular hemorrhage (IVH) or death. Objectives To assess the short-term outcome of VLBWI on IVH according to mode of delivery in a population-based cohort of the German Neonatal Network (GNN). Study design A total cohort of 2203 singleton VLBWI with a birth weight < 1500 g and gestational age between 22 0/7 and 36 6/7 weeks born and discharged between 1st of January 2009 and 31st of December 2015 was available for analysis. VLBWI were stratified into three categories according to mode of delivery: (1) planned cesarean section (n = 1381), (2) vaginal delivery (n = 632) and (3) emergency cesarean section (n = 190). Outcome was assessed in univariate and logistic regression analyses. Results Prevalence of IVH was significantly higher in the vaginal delivery (VD) (26.6%) and emergency CS group (31.1%) as compared to planned CS (17.2%), respectively. In a logistic regression analysis including known risk factors for IVH, vaginal delivery (OR 1.725 1.325 −2.202, p ≤ 0.001) and emergency cesarean section (OR 1.916 1.338 −2.746, p ≤ 0.001) were independently associated with IVH risk. In the subgroup of infants > 30 weeks of gestation prevalence for IVH was not significantly different in VD and planned CS (5.3% vs. 4.4%). Conclusions Our observational data demonstrate that elective cesarean section is associated with a reduced risk of IVH in preterm infants <30 weeks gestational age when presenting with preterm labor.
Aim
In animal studies, aminoglycosides induced ductus arteriosus relaxation in a dose‐dependent fashion. We tested the hypothesis that antibiotic treatment of preterm infants with aminoglycosides is ...associated with higher rates of surgical patent ductus arteriosus (PDA) closure.
Methods
Preterm infants (birthweight <1000 grams or gestational age <29 weeks) enrolled in 62 German neonatal intensive care units (NICUs) were analysed. NICUs were stratified according to the use of aminoglycosides as first‐line antibiotics.
Results
Baseline data were not different when NICUs using aminoglycosides (n = 9965 infants) were compared to NICUs using other antibiotics (n = 1948 infants). Rates of surgical PDA closure were 5.9% for NICUs using aminoglycosides; 6.2% for units using gentamicin; and 5.0% for NICUs using tobramycin compared to 4.1% in NICUs using other antibiotics (P < .001, P < .001 and P = .140, respectively, Fisher's exact test). Indomethacin and ibuprofen use was more common in NICUs using aminoglycosides (41% vs 33%, P < .001, Fisher's exact test). Gentamicin trough levels were higher in NICUs with surgical closure rates above the mean (median 2.0 µg/mL, inter‐quartile range 0.8‐4.0 µg/mL vs 1.2 µg/mL, IQR 0.8‐1.7, P < .001, Mann‐Whitney U test).
Conclusion
First‐line antibiotic treatment of preterm infants with aminoglycosides was associated with higher rates of surgical PDA closure.
Abstract
Background
Respiratory distress syndrome is the main cause of mortality and morbidity in preterm infants. “Less invasive surfactant administration” (LISA), which describes intratracheal ...surfactant administration to spontaneously breathing infants via a small diameter tube, is recommended as the first-line treatment in preterm infants with more than 30% supplemental oxygen. Prophylactic use of LISA in preterm infants with less than 30% supplemental oxygen was not tested in randomised controlled trials yet, and long-term outcome data of the procedure are scarce.
Methods
Preterm infants with a gestational age between 25 weeks + 0 days and 28 weeks + 6 days who are breathing spontaneously on continuous positive airway pressure with supplemental oxygen at or below 30% in the first hour of life will be randomised to a prophylactic LISA treatment with 100–200 mg surfactant intratracheally per kilogramme bodyweight (intervention group) or will continue the continuous positive airway pressure treatment (control group). Participants will have follow-up until age 5 years. At that time, the children will be tested by spirometry, and forced expiratory volume within 1-s
z
-scores will be compared between the intervention and control groups as the primary outcome parameter of the trial. Secondary endpoints include additional lung function parameters, endurance, motor development, intelligence, and sensitivity for infectious lung diseases. Short-term safety assessment will be done after completed enrolment (
n
= 698) and discharge of all infants. This safety assessment will include in-hospital mortality and short-term complications.
Discussion
Robust data concerning the possible long-term benefits of prophylactic LISA treatment are lacking. The current observational data from the German Neonatal Network indicate that approximately 50% of preterm infants with supplemental oxygen at or below 30% within the first hour of life are treated with LISA. The pro.LISA trial will provide short- and long-term outcomes of preterm infants receiving prophylactic treatment and will clarify if prophylactic treatment should be given to all preterm infants or if the current practice of selective treatment if supplemental oxygen exceeds 30% is more appropriate.

Associations of APOE genotypes with intracerebral hemorrhage (ICH) in preterm infants were previously described. In adults, APOE-ε4 genotype has been proposed as susceptibility factor for impaired ...recovery after cerebral insult. We here aim to determine APOE genotype-specific neurological consequences of neonatal ICH at school age.
In this multicenter observational cohort study, very low birth weight (<1500 g, <32 weeks gestational age) children were studied for cerebral palsy (CP) after ultrasound diagnosed ICH stratified by APOE genotype. Follow-up examination was done at the age of 5 to 6 years. Study personnel were blinded for perinatal information and complications. Participants were born between January 1, 2009 and December 31, 2013 and enrolled in the German Neonatal Network. Of 8022 infants primarily enrolled, 2467 children were invited for follow-up between January 1, 2014 and December 31, 2019. Univariate analyses and multivariate logistic regression models were used to assess the impact of APOE genotype (APOE-ε2, APOE-ε3, APOE-ε4) on CP after ICH.
Two thousand two hundred fifteen children participated at follow-up, including 363 children with ultrasound diagnosed neonatal ICH. In univariate analyses of children with a history of ICH, APOE-ε3 carriers had lower frequencies of CP (n=33/250; 13.2 95% CI, 9.4%-17.8%), as compared to APOE-ε2 (n=15/63; 23.8 14.6%-35.3%,
=0.037) and -ε4 carriers (n=31/107; 29.0 21.0%-38.0%,
<0.001), respectively. Regression models revealed an association of APOE-ε4 genotype and CP development (odds ratio, 2.77 1.44-5.32,
=0.002) after ICH. Notably, at low-grade ICH (grade I) APOE-ε4 expression resulted in an increased rate of CP (n=6/39; 15.4 6.7-29.0) in comparison to APOE-ε3 (n=2/105; 1.9 0.4%-6.0%,
=0.002).
APOE-ε4 carriers have an increased risk for long-term motor deficits after ICH. We assume an effect even after low-grade neonatal ICH, but more data are needed to clarify this issue.
Sepsis is regarded as a risk factor for brain injury in preterm infants. We herein hypothesize that extremely low birth weight infants (ELBWI, birth weight <1,000 g) having survived recurrent blood ...culture-proven late-onset sepsis (LOS) episodes are more likely to have an adverse long-term neurologic outcome.
In a large multicenter observational study of ELBWI ≤28 6/7 weeks, we evaluated the impact of recurrent LOS (blood culture-proven, after day 7 of life) on development at 5-6 years. Neurodevelopment, behavior, and motor qualities were tested by blinded investigators. Univariate and logistic regression analyses were performed.
The cohort consisted of 1343 ELBWI including 1,080 infants without LOS, 186 infants with one LOS, and 77 with recurrent LOS, i.e., 55 infants with two and 22 infants with three LOS episodes. After Bonferroni-Holm correction, multiple logistic regression analysis revealed recurrent sepsis to be significantly associated with adverse motor development (critical MABC-2 testing: 3.3 1.5-7.3, p = 0.003, pB = 0.012), whereas no significant impact of recurrent LOS was found on intelligence quotient and behavioral difficulties. Odds of having critical motor testing results for infants with recurrent LOS were 1.7 times (95% confidence interval 1.4-2.3) that of infants with one LOS.
Recurrent sepsis in preterm infants is associated with adverse long-term motor development. However, infants with recurrent infections are also more likely to have preterm-related complications, and reasons for a worse neurodevelopmental outcome remain to be elucidated.
Vancomycin is an extensively used anti-infective drug in neonatal ICUs. However, exposure-toxicity relationships have not been clearly defined.
To evaluate the risk profile for hearing deficits in ...vancomycin-exposed very-low-birthweight infants (VLBWI).
In a large cohort study of the German Neonatal Network (GNN; n = 16 967 VLBWI) we assessed the association of vancomycin treatment and pathological hearing tests at discharge and at 5 year follow-up. We performed audits on vancomycin exposure, drug levels, dose adjustments and exposure to other ototoxic drugs in a subgroup of 1042 vancomycin-treated VLBWI.
In the GNN cohort, 28% (n = 4739) were exposed to IV vancomycin therapy. In multivariable logistic regression analysis, vancomycin exposure proved to be independently associated with pathological hearing test at discharge (OR 1.18, 95% CI 1.03-1.34, P = 0.016). Among vancomycin-treated infants, a cumulative vancomycin dose above the upper quartile (>314 mg/kg bodyweight) was associated with pathological hearing test at discharge (OR 2.1, 95% CI 1.21-3.64, P = 0.009), whereas a vancomycin cumulative dose below the upper quartile was associated with a reduced risk of pathological tone audiometry results at 5 years of age (OR 0.29, 95% CI 0.1-0.8, P = 0.02, n = 147).
Vancomycin exposure in VLBWI is associated with an increased, dose-dependent risk of pathological hearing test results at discharge and at 5 years of age. Prospective studies on long-term hearing impairment are needed.
Aim
To determine the regional cerebral tissue oxygenation saturation (rcSO2) in a group of infants requiring less invasive surfactant administration (LISA) as compared to infants with continuous ...positive airway pressure (CPAP) only.
Methods
In preterm infants with a gestational age 26 0/7‐31 6/7 weeks, we conducted an observational study using near‐infrared spectroscopy (NIRS) in the first 120 hours of life.
Results
We analysed the data of 22 infants who never received surfactant (CPAP), 22 infants had LISA and CPAP (LISA) and 6 infants received surfactant via endotracheal tube (ETT). Four infants had both surfactant application modes including six LISA applications. In total, there were 32 successful LISA applications but 44 attempts; 13/44 (30%) of LISA attempts resulted in a 20% decrease of rcSO2. During the first 120 hours of life, rcSO2 values of CPAP were similar to those of infants in the LISA group, that is median rcSO2 values 90% vs 85%, respectively (P = .126). Episodes with rcSO2 values <65% were 0.4% in the CPAP group as compared to 4.8% in the LISA group (P < .001).
Conclusion
Our observational data indicate that rcSO2 values of infants in the LISA group were similar to the CPAP group.
To determine if survival rates of preterm infants receiving active perinatal care improve over time.
The German Neonatal Network is a cohort study of preterm infants with birth weight <1500 g. All ...eligible infants receiving active perinatal care are registered. We analysed data of patients discharged between 2011 and 2016.
43 German level III neonatal intensive care units (NICUs).
8222 preterm infants with a gestational age between 22/0 and 28/6 weeks who received active perinatal care.
Participating NICUs were grouped according to their specific survival rate from 2011 to 2013 to high (percentile >P75), intermediate (P25-P75) and low (<P25) survival. We compared these survival rates with data in 2014-2016.
Death by any cause before discharge.
Total survival increased from 85.8% in 2011-2013 to 87.4% in 2014-2016. This increase was due to reduced mortality of NICUs with low survival rates in 2011-2013. Survival increased in these centres from 53% to 64% in the 22-24 weeks strata and from 73% to 84% in the 25-26 weeks strata.
Our data support previous reports that active perinatal care of very immature infants improves outcomes at the border of viability and survival rates at higher gestational ages. The high total number of surviving infants below 24 weeks of gestation challenges national recommendations exclusively referring to gestational age as the single criterion for providing active care. However, more data are needed before recommendations for parental counselling should be reconsidered.
